    Britney M.

    Garlic bread 6/10 Caprese salad 6/10 Iced tea 9/10 Fettuccine Alfredo 2/10 Chicken Marsala 7/10 Hours of operation 1/10 Seating 1/10 We've been waiting to try this place for a while. The issue we had was every time we would come here, they were closed. The hours are on Yelp and on their website. We would call when it was the "open hours," and they would tell us they were CLOSED. We have walked over to this place at 1:30pm and it was CLOSED. When they are supposed to be open until 3pm. So, the hours of operation are confusing and appear to change on a whim. How do you run a business like this? Very unprofessional when customers never know when the restaurant is open. The dine-in experience was not good. The chairs are hard wood with no padding. My chair was uneven and rocked back and forth. There is not air-conditioning, so it got hot inside. The better seats might be the "patio" area, so you at least get a breeze. Seating is cramped. The restaurant is TINY. Seriously, I have wide hips and had a hard time walking in and out of the restaurant without bumping into chairs. On to the food. If the hours of operation and the cramped seating wasn't enough. The food added to disappointment. We started off with appetizers; garlic bread and caprese salad. The garlic bread was sort of bland tasting. The weakest garlic bread I've had. Where is the butter flavor? It was super basic garlic bread. I think I could have made better garlic bread at home. The caprese salad was good, but the tomatoes were wayyy too thick. I mean the tomato over-powered the mozzarella cheese. It didn't have good balance of all the flavors. Chicken marsala was alright my partner said. And my fettuccine alfredo was very disappointing. The alfredo sauce wasn't thick and creamy the way I like it. It didn't have a cheesy, buttery, depth to it with garlic. It was watery, runny alfredo sauce with basic flavor. Tasted like plain noodles with diluted alfredo sauce (something you would serve from the kid's menu). Never going back here. There are far too many great Italian places to eat at in Orange County. Makes this place look like a joke.

    Kaleido Rolls in the Fashion Island food court, Newport Beach, is known for fresh and healthy…read morespring rolls. The concept reimagines Vietnamese style rice paper rolls with unconventional, flavorful fillings and specialized sauces.  The rolls are fresh, tasty, and "packed" with ingredients. Popular, unique options include Chicken Caesar with approximately 22 gram of protein, Spicy Tuna, Smoked Salmon, Prosciutto, and shrimp. They creative combinations like smoked salmon with horseradish cream cheese or prosciutto with mozzarella. The menu is gluten free, and roughly half of the options are vegan like roasted eggplant. Kaleido Rolls is highly recommended for those looking for a light, healthy, and high-quality lunch or snack, particularly if you are in the Newport Beach area and want a fresh alternative to heavier, fried, or fast-food options.
